
July 19, 1983... The Kinards, the Richardses and the Webbers - Seattle's Kennedys. Their 'compound' - elegant Forrester Square...until the fateful night that tore these families apart. Twenty years later... Living in America was everything Kara Tamaki had dreamed it would be while growing up in Japan. Now she didn't want to leave - at least not until her baby was born. But her visa had expired, and returning home could bring shame to her family. Seattle lawyer Daniel Adler was her last hope. Daniel wasn't an immigration lawyer, and he really wasn't sure how he could help Kara...until he met her. The sweet-faced, determined young woman sparked an uncharacteristic desire in Daniel to protect her - a desire that quickly threatened to overwhelm his better judgement. He could help Kara stay in America...by marrying her.
